Award for Catering Excellence, Primary Team of the Year

This award goes to a team who have demonstrated a high level of enthusiasm, initiative, commitment and effort and have implemented activities to increase awareness of, or support the school’s food service. The award is for a team who have maintained a consistent professional standard in their day to day work.

Finalists
Craigowl Primary School, Dundee – Linda, Cook in Charge, and her team at Craigowl Primary are worthy of recognition for their collective and individual contributions towards the catering service provision to pupils and staff at the school and for their involvement in activities that benefit the continuous development and improvement of the wider school meal service. The team always pull together to deliver and efficient and enjoyable meal experience for their customers and never lose sight of the fact that the meal experience has to be fun for the customer.


New Hills Primary School, Perth & Kinross – the team at New Hills primary works well on all levels with an entirely new set up since last year. Fiona and her team understand that good marketing is the essence of greater business. Pupils, teachers and supervisory staff are incorporated in Fiona’s marketing days. These have included Fruity Fridays, Teddy Bear Picnics, Disney themed days and many more, which encourage children to come to lunch and educate them in nutrition.


Whitehills Primary School, Angus – Linda is the Cook in Charge and, along with her team at Whitehills, manages a slick operation where they produce meals for three dining centres. Linda and her team have developed and managed to work very closely with all four schools and have created a genuine working partnership. The team are very reliable, enthusiastic and very committed at all times and consistently raise the bar to promote and develop the school meal service.

Winner – Craigowl Primary School, Dundee. The Craigowl catering team embrace the concept of a ‘whole school approach’ with enthusiasm, working in close partnership with the school staff to promote health and well-being through the school meal service. Linda works very closely with the ‘Eating for Health’ Assistant to promote school lunches and is always on hand to answer any questions the children may have about school dining. The team have set the bar in terms of customer care and although they are very busy they take the time to talk to the children and they firmly believe that a happy customer is a returning customer.
